Output 676c6e68595327c883657c2e37c8a95897fd1babaaba7e0b8dcb145da5b4bb0f:7

value
654000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f07e9218d7d575beb4f3adb6679eda3fb6ea96d2 OP_EQUAL
address
3PcdisMATAkv8bizvVWCasezr2RFeFH26e
transaction
676c6e68595327c883657c2e37c8a95897fd1babaaba7e0b8dcb145da5b4bb0f
confirmations
431709
spent
true